A desperate need for: ElderCare QUALITY Political… Community Living Assistance Services and Supports Act “CLASS Act” • Title VIII • Establishment of a National Voluntary Insurance Program for Purchasing community Living Assistance Services and Supports in order to: • Provide individuals who have functional limitations the tools which will allow them to maintain their personal and financial independence and life in the community • Provide infrastructure that will help address the nation's community living assistance services and supports needs • Alleviate burdens on family caregivers • Address institutional bias by providing financing mechanism that supports personal change and independence to live in the community Image credited to: http://blogs.cdc.gov/publichealthmatters/2012/09/emergencies-and-the-elderly/

A desperate need for: ElderCare QUALITY Political… Health Care Workforce • Title V • Improve access, delivery to individuals by: • gathering and accessing comprehensive data…including research on supply, demand, distribution, diversity, and skills needs of the health care workforce • increasing the supply of a qualified health care workforce • enhancing health care workforce education and training • providing support to the existing health care workforce Image credited to: http://blogs.cdc.gov/publichealthmatters/2012/09/emergencies-and-the-elderly/

A desperate need for: ElderCare QUALITY Political… Geriatric Components (financial assistance) • Geriatric Components • Grant funding opportunities (fellowships) - Short-term incentive focusing on geriatrics, chronic care management and long term care. • Must offer 2 courses each year (minimal/no cost) to family caregivers and direct care providers instruction on management psychological and behavioral aspects of dementia… OR • Develop and include material on depression and other mental disorder common among older adults, medication safety issues for older adults, and management of psychological and behavioral aspects of dementia and communication techniques • $150,000/24 facilities for FFY 2011 to 2014 = $6250 Image credited to: http://blogs.cdc.gov/publichealthmatters/2012/09/emergencies-and-the-elderly/

A desperate need for: ElderCare QUALITY Political… Geriatric Components (financial assistance) • Geriatric Components • Geriatric Career Incentive Awards - Monies offered to individuals who foster greater interest among a variety of health professionals in the field of geriatric, long-term cares, and chronic care management • Teach or practice the above for a minimum of 5 years • Board certified/eligible in : internal medicine, family practice, psychiatry, dentistry …(or anything the Secretary deeps acceptable and approves. • Have completed the fellowship • Have a junior (no-tenured) faculty appointment at an accredited school of medicine, osteopathic medicine… • $10 Billion for the FFY 2010 to 2013 Image credited to: http://blogs.cdc.gov/publichealthmatters/2012/09/emergencies-and-the-elderly/
